This Victorian building is situated in the heart of Birmingham. Nearby you will find many attractions such as Museums, Music Halls, Shopping and Convention Centres. The Comfort Inn Birmingham is a red- bricked Victorian building, one of the oldest in the city dating back to 1883. Located in the heart of Birmingham in close proximity to the Old Rep Theatre, many famous people have stayed there such as Charlie Chaplin. Over the past years with Birmingham City being redeveloped into a cosmopolitan city, the Comfort Inn is ideally situated for those guests wanting to take advantage of the central attractions. Such attractions include Broad Street, International Convention Centre, Symphony Hall, National Indoor Arena and Chinatown. All are located within a few minutes walk.
